fully cooked CHICKEN BREAST BITES
Summary
The product contains chicken breast, which is a high-quality source of lean protein, but it is classified as ultra-processed due to the presence of additives like natural flavors and starches. While the ingredient list is relatively short and lacks harmful additives like seed oils or artificial colors, the use of natural flavors and the processing level limit its healthiness. The macros are favorable, but the processing level prevents a higher score.

Chicken breastVery Good
Chicken breast is a high-quality source of lean protein, essential for muscle growth and repair. It is minimally processed and provides a rich amino acid profile. Compared to other protein sources, it is low in fat and calories, making it a healthy choice.
Benefits
Rich in protein, which is essential for muscle maintenance and overall health. Low in fat and calories, making it suitable for weight management.
WaterNeutral
Water is used as a solvent and to maintain moisture in food products. It is a neutral ingredient with no direct nutritional impact. Its presence ensures the product remains moist and palatable.

VinegarNeutral
Vinegar is used as a preservative and flavor enhancer in food products. It is a natural ingredient that can help extend shelf life. Its acidity can also enhance the taste profile of the product.
Benefits
May aid in preservation and enhance flavor without adding calories.
Natural flavorBad
Natural flavors are often used to enhance taste but can be highly processed and lack transparency. They may contain a variety of chemical compounds derived from natural sources. The lack of specificity can be concerning for those with allergies or sensitivities.
Risks
Potential for allergic reactions or sensitivities due to undisclosed compounds.
Potato starchNeutral
Potato starch is used as a thickening agent and to improve texture in food products. It is a refined carbohydrate with minimal nutritional value. It helps maintain the product's consistency and mouthfeel.
